What is a grid tied solar system?
A grid tied solar system is the most popular and cost-effective way to harness solar energy for your home or business. Unlike off-grid systems that require expensive battery storage, grid-tied systems connect directly to your local utility grid, allowing you to generate clean electricity while maintaining reliable power access 24/7.

What is a grid-connected solar system?
A grid-connected solar system, also known as an on-grid or grid-tied solar system, is a photovoltaic (PV) system that is directly connected to the public utility grid. This system generates electricity from solar panels and feeds it into the grid.

A Container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) refers to a modular, scalable energy storage solution that houses batteries, power electronics, and control systems within a standardized shipping container.
